Shaun Higley is a Licensed Marriage Family Therapist (License #162599). He has been with Focus since 2020. Shaun is available for crisis intervention and scheduled individual video telehealth therapy sessions.
Shaun’s primary specialization and experience is in individual trauma focused approaches to include helping clients manage rauma, anxiety, depression, grief/loss, and substance use. Shaun’s therapeutic modality incorporates a combination of interventions to include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, Dialectical Behavioral Therapy, Acceptance and Commitment Therapy, Motivational Interviewing as well as Mindfulness Based techniques. Additionally, he is certified in suicide prevention.
Prior experience includes providing individual and group services to homeless military veterans at Veterans' Village San Diego (VVSD). This experience revolved around helping clients work through trauma related issues such as combat, childhood and sexual trauma, crisis intervention as well as substance use interventions. At VVSD, Shaun facilitated group therapy sessions to include Substance Use, Anger Management, life skills development, and Art Therapy. Shaun also spent time providing clinical services to at-risk youth who had been removed from care-givers homes by Child Welfare Services at New Alternatives–Polinsky Children’s Center San Diego.
Before becoming a therapist, Shaun served 9 years active duty/1 year reserve in the United States Air Force working in Force Support Services and in Security Forces both with deployed experience. In February of 2020, Shaun earned his Master of Arts degree in Counseling Psychology specializing in Marriage and Family Therapy from National University.
Additional training and experience include Emergency Responder and Public Safety, Individuals in Crisis and Group Crisis Intervention and Trauma Professional Certified. Shaun has significant experience with conducting Critical Incident Stress Management defusing/debriefings with multiple local first responder agencies. Shaun operated as a fully embedded clinician within the Wellness Unit at the San Diego Police Department.
